Compare Pepperstone vs multibank exchange group Commission And Fees
Pepperstone and multibank exchange group are online broker platforms, and most online brokerages charge lower fees than traditional brokerages tend to charge. The cause of this is that the businesses of online trading platforms are scaled better. In other words, an online broker is not necessarily influenced by the amount of clients they have.
However, this does not necessarily mean that online brokers do not charge any fees. They charge fees of varying rates for various services to make money. There are primarily three different types of fees for this objective.
The first sort of charges to look out for are trading fees. When you make an actual trade, like purchasing a stock or an ETF, you're charged trading fees. In such instances, you're paying a spread, funding speed, or even a commission. The kinds of trading charges and the rates differ from broker to broker.
Commissions can be fixed or dependent on the traded volume. On the flip side, a spread refers to the difference between the buying and selling cost. Funding or overnight prices are people who are charged when you maintain a leveraged position for more than a day.
Apart from trading charges, online agents also charge non-trading fees. These are determined by the activities you undertake on your account. They're billed for surgeries like depositing cash, not investing for long periods, or withdrawals.
